Oracle Retail is an enterprise-grade suite of retail management software that handles merchandising, point-of-sale (POS), inventory, and supply chain operations across various retail formats. For gas station accounting, it supports fuel pump integration via Oracle Retail Xstore POS, tracks inventory for fuel and convenience store items, and provides financial reporting with compliance tools adaptable to fuel taxes. However, it excels more in large-scale retail chains than standalone gas stations, often requiring customization for specialized fuel accounting like tank gauging or environmental reporting.

QuickBooks Enterprise is a comprehensive accounting platform from Intuit tailored for mid-to-large businesses, providing advanced inventory tracking, payroll, financial reporting, and multi-location management. For gas stations, it excels in general bookkeeping, fuel and retail inventory management, sales tax handling, and POS integrations, making it suitable for chains tracking convenience store items alongside fuel sales. While powerful, it lacks native fuel-specific tools like tank gauging or automated excise tax filings, often requiring third-party add-ons for full optimization.

Xero is a cloud-based accounting software designed for small to medium businesses, offering invoicing, bank reconciliation, expense tracking, and financial reporting. For gas stations, it provides general ledger management and integrations with POS systems, but lacks specialized tools for fuel inventory, pump sales tracking, or excise tax compliance. It's suitable for basic accounting needs but requires third-party apps for industry-specific functions like managing gallons sold or convenience store stock.

Sage 50cloud is a cloud-connected accounting software primarily designed for small to medium-sized businesses, providing core features like general ledger, accounts payable/receivable, inventory management, and payroll processing. For gas stations, it handles basic fuel and convenience store inventory tracking, sales invoicing, and financial reporting, but lacks specialized tools for pump integrations or petroleum-specific taxes. Its customizable modules allow some adaptation to industry needs, with cloud access enhancing remote management for multi-location operations.
